Overview

Potassium fluoride (KF) is an ionic compound composed of potassium and fluorine ions. It is industrially significant due to its role as a fluorinating agent and its ability to form stable complexes with metals. The compound is produced by neutralizing hydrofluoric acid with potassium hydroxide or carbonate. In industrial contexts, KF is valued for its reactivity and solubility, making it a versatile intermediate in chemical synthesis. It is commonly available in anhydrous or dihydrate forms, with the former preferred for moisture-sensitive applications.

Physical and Chemical Properties

KF exhibits a cubic crystal structure similar to sodium chloride. Its high solubility in water and polar solvents enables use in liquid-phase reactions. The compound is hygroscopic, absorbing moisture to form a corrosive solution that can attack glass and metals. Thermally, KF is stable up to its melting point (858°C), beyond which it decomposes to release toxic fluorine gases. It reacts vigorously with acids to produce hydrofluoric acid, necessitating careful handling. Analytical-grade KF typically has a purity of ≥99%, with trace metals as impurities.

Main Applications

In metallurgy, KF serves as a flux for aluminum and rare earth metal production, lowering melting points and removing oxides. The glass industry uses it for etching and frosting surfaces through controlled reactions with silica. Organic synthesis employs KF as a fluorination catalyst, particularly in nucleophilic aromatic substitutions. Additional uses include wood preservatives, dental treatments (fluoride source), and specialty electrolytes. Emerging applications involve lithium-ion battery components and nuclear fuel processing.

Safety and Storage

KF requires strict safety protocols due to its acute toxicity (oral LD50: 245 mg/kg in rats). Personnel must wear acid-resistant gloves, goggles, and respirators when handling powdered forms. Spills should be neutralized with calcium carbonate or lime. Storage demands airtight containers with desiccants to prevent moisture absorption. Incompatible materials include glass, aluminum, and strong acids. Facilities must maintain eyewash stations and HF antidote (calcium gluconate gel) for emergency response.

B2B Procurement Guide

Industrial buyers should prioritize suppliers with ISO 9001 certification and batch-specific certificates of analysis. Key specifications include purity (≥99%), chloride content (<0.01%), and particle size (40-100 mesh for most applications). Bulk shipments (25kg bags or 1-ton pallets) typically offer better pricing. Evaluate logistics providers for hazardous material transport compliance (UN 1812 for KF solutions). Consider regional stock availability due to export restrictions in some countries.
